In terms of where individuals see or hear media criticism, we find social media (49%) pointed out frequently, adhered to by chats with individuals offline (36%) and afterwards various other media outlets (35%) such as tv and radio. The bad-mouthing of journalists is not brand-new, yet assaults can currently be amplified quicker than ever via a variety of electronic and social channels in ways that are commonly carefully collaborated, in some cases paid for, and doing not have in openness. Media objection has actually come to be an essential part of the political playbook, a means to deflect criticism and frighten investigations– and these methods often arrive at productive ground. These decreases in news interest are shown in lower usage of both standard and on the internet media sources for the most part. The proportion that claim they did not consume any kind of information in the last week from conventional or on the internet sources (TV, radio, print, online, or social media) has raised once again this year across nations.
